• I recently installed the new blog stat plugin (the one which is used on all the wordpress.com blogs). But when I check the blog stats thru my dashboard, it asks me to log in to my wordpress.com account!

    Why is that so?

    What if someone does not have a wordpress.com account? Or if I plan to delete mine?

    The stats are computed by wordpress.com, so that’s where the reports are generated. You need an API key to activate the plugin, therefore you must have a WP.com account.

    They should tell you right up front, in plain language: When you go to view your stats you actually go to your WP.com Global Dashboard to view them.

    The API key to activate isn’t surprising and it is mentioned in the requirements — everyone has done the same thing to activate Akismet. But with Akismet, your spam admin is still within YOUR wordpress on your domain, you don’t have to login or surf to .Com

    For me at least, once I logged in the first time, it hasn’t been a problem. It’s easy. But it was surprising.

    @thesp2, You need-not keep a blog on .com for this plugin to work (if you delete a blog on there, no problem). You just need an account.
